  • Publication number: 20090132783
    Abstract: In a particular embodiment, a method is disclosed that includes executing a single instruction to identify a location within a table stored at a memory. The single instruction is executable by a processor to extract bit field data from a first register and insert the bit field data into an index portion of a second register. The second register includes a table address portion and an index portion. The table address portion includes a table address identifying a memory location associated with a table. The table address and the bit field data combine to form an indexed address to an element within the table.

  • Publication number: 20090119477
    Abstract: The disclosure includes a method and system of configuring a translation lookaside buffer (TLB). In an embodiment, the TLB includes a first portion and a second portion. The first portion or the second portion may be selectively disabled in response to a value of a TLB configuration indicator.

  • Patent number: 7526633
    Abstract: Techniques for processing transmissions in a communications (e.g., CDMA) system. The method and system encode and process instructions of mixed lengths (e.g., 16 bits and 32 bits) and instruction packets including instructions of mixed lengths. This includes encoding a plurality of instructions of a first length and a plurality of instructions of a second length. The method and system encode a header having at least one instruction length bit. The instruction bit distinguishes between instructions of the first length and instructions of the second length for an associated DSP to process in a mixed stream. The method and system distinguish between the instructions of the first length and the instructions of the second length according to the contents of the instruction length bits. The header further includes bits for distinguishing between instructions of varying lengths in an instruction packet.

  • Publication number: 20080034189
    Abstract: A method and system to perform shifting and rounding operations within a microprocessor, such as, for example, a digital signal processor, during execution of a single instruction are described. An instruction to shift and round data within a source register unit of a register file structure is received within a processing unit. The instruction includes a shifting bit value indicating the bit amount for a right shift operation and is subsequently executed to shift data within the source register unit to the right by an encoded bit value, calculated by subtracting a single bit from the shifting bit value contained within the instruction. A predetermined bit extension is further inserted within the vacated bit positions adjacent to the shifted data. Subsequently, an addition operation is performed on the shifted data and a unitary integer value is added to the shifted data to obtain resulting data.

  • Publication number: 20080016316
    Abstract: A method and system to indicate which page within a software-managed page table triggers an exception within a microprocessor, such as, for example, a digital signal processor, wherein a software-managed translation lookaside buffer (TLB) module receives a virtual address produced by an instruction within a Very Long Instruction Word (VLIW) packet, such as, for example, a fetch instruction, and further compares the virtual address to each stored TLB entry. If a match exists, then the TLB module outputs a corresponding mapped physical address for the instruction. Otherwise, if the VLIW packet spans two pages, where a first page is present as a TLB entry within the TLB module and the second page is missing from the stored TLB entries, an indication bit within a data field of a control register is set to identify the TLB miss exception to a software management unit.

  • Publication number: 20070266229
    Abstract: Methods and apparatus for encoding information regarding a hardware loop of a set of packets is provided, each packet (400) containing instructions. The information is encoded into one or more bits of at least one instruction (300) in the set of packets. The information may indicate whether a packet is or is not an end packet of the loop. Information regarding two hardware loops may be encoded where information regarding the first loop is encoded into an instruction at a first position in each packet and information regarding the second loop is encoded into an instruction at a second position in each packet. End instruction information may be encoded into an instruction not having encoded loop information at the same bit positions reserved for the encoded loop information, the end instruction information indicating whether an instruction is the last instruction of a packet and the length of a packet.
